Frequently Asked Questions about River Green

What type of rentals are currently available in River Green?

There are currently 45 Apartments for Rent in River Green, GA with pricing that ranges from $1,178 to $5,384. There are also 68 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in River Green ranging from $1,000 to $10,750.

What is the current price range for Rental Homes in River Green?

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in River Green ranges from $1,000 to $10,750 with an average monthly rent of $2,606.

How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in River Green?

For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in River Green range from $1,449 to $5,065,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,750 to $4,500.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$2,049 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$5,384.
